Gabriela Women’s Party Representatives Luz Ilagan and Emmi De Jesus lauded today the approval of the Reproductive Health Bill at the House of Representatives Committee on Appropriations as a victory for Filipino women and a challenge to further the struggle for healthcare and services.

"Today's approval of the RH Bill is another step forward in the assertion of women's rights to quality health care, and what we saw today was a spirit of jubilation from the broad range of groups and individuals supporting this process,” said De Jesus.

“It is high time. The approval of the RH Bill is but an appropriate response to poor women’s clamor for healthcare and basic social services. Amid growing poverty, what we need is to institute a government policy that will ensure that women and children are given access to information and healthcare,” said Ilagan.

The Gabriela solons, proponents of the Comprehensive Reproductive Health Bill which was consolidated along with five other measures on Reproductive Health believe that the bill will continue to gather steam in the legislative mill as more and more women from thegrassroots actively lobby for the measure.

"What we foresee is a continuing gathering of the RH momentum which will ensure passage at the plenary as well as in the bicameral proceedings in the near future. Beyond this then, what we need to safeguard is its pro-poor orientation. This means access to RH services, programs and products that are safe, scientific, culturally appropriate and affordable. To this end that RH becomes a reality for poor women.” #
